游戏ai如何制作
一、游戏AI概述
游戏AI,即人工智能,是游戏开发中不可或缺的一部分。它能够模拟人类的思维和行为,为玩家提供更加丰富和有趣的交互体验。随着技术的发展,游戏AI已经从简单的控制角色跟随玩家,发展到能够自主思考、决策和行动,为游戏增添了更多的挑战性和趣味性。
二、游戏AI制作流程:
在制作游戏AI时,我们需要明确游戏AI的目标和任务,这是设计其行为策略的基础。接下来,我们需要设计游戏AI的行为策略,这需要考虑到游戏类型、角色设定、场景等因素。在实现游戏AI的代码结构时,我们需要考虑到游戏的性能和稳定性。最后,我们需要对游戏AI进行测试和优化,确保其能够正确地完成任务,并且能够适应各种不同的环境和情况。
三、游戏AI的挑战与解决方案:
游戏AI的开发过程中,面临着许多挑战,如智能决策和行为生成、动态环境和适应性、避免重复行为和决策错误等。为了解决这些问题,我们可以利用现有的技术和工具,如机器学习、强化学习等技术。此外,我们还可以借鉴人类智能的原理和方法,如博弈论、心理学等,来设计更加智能的游戏AI。
总之,游戏AI的制作需要综合考虑多个因素,包括目标、任务、策略、代码结构、测试和优化等。通过不断尝试和探索,我们可以逐步提高游戏AI的智能程度和表现水平,为玩家带来更加丰富和有趣的交互体验。
九软件 版权声明:以上发布的内容及图片均来源于网络,如有无意侵犯到您的权利,请联系我们及时删除!